Subject: DR drill — quota service failover

Hi Marit,

Next Tuesday we'll run the disaster-recovery drill for the per-tenant rate quota service on Fennelgate. Quota counters will be restored from the Brindleport replica, so expect brief throttling drift. To unseal the standby quota store during the drill, use the passphrase below.

unlock words, hahip-baduf: holwyn-istath-julvan

The Inkrender pipeline converts user markdown to sanitized HTML in three stages: parse (Quillbox), sanitize (allowlist only, no raw HTML passthrough), and render. All embeds are proxied; no external fetches at render time. Known risk areas: footnote IDs and table alignment attributes. Sanitizer rules are versioned and change-reviewed. The current allowlist and bypass history are documented on the page below.

operations page: https://rundeck.ferradata.local/issue/dash/merge_requests/secrets/d01946f423debaa0

### Account Recovery — Catalogue Import (Lintwood)

Quick one for review: when the Lintwood catalogue import wipes a patron's session table, the recovery flow re-seeds accounts from the nightly snapshot. Check that the importer skips locked accounts — last time it didn't. To rerun recovery against staging you'll need the vault passphrase, which is appended just below.

recovery phrase for yafof-tajof: julmir-kelax-julvan-holath-belvan-holir-ralael-ralvan-ralath-julvan-silmir-istmir-kaswyn-ulamir

Welcome to the LiftSim on-call rotation. LiftSim is Vantrell Systems' elevator-dispatch simulator used to replay dispatch traffic from the Harwick test towers. Most pages you receive will be stale scenario locks; clear them with the reset job and re-queue the run. If the simulator's state store becomes unreadable, you will need to restore from the sealed snapshot, which requires the admin recovery passphrase. Keep it offline and never paste it into chat. For reference during a live incident, the passphrase is as follows.

strongbox words: norwyn-wenael-aldvan-aldiel-wendor-holael